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 203628-87-9 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 2,0,3,6,2 and 8 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 8 and 7 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 203628-87:
(8*2)+(7*0)+(6*3)+(5*6)+(4*2)+(3*8)+(2*8)+(1*7)=119
119 % 10 = 9
So 203628-87-9 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Experimental studies of Lewis acid catalyzed additions of long chained alcohols to activated 1,4-benzoquinone

Hormi, Osmo E.O.,Moilanen, Anu M.

, p. 1943 - 1952 (2007/10/03)

Lewis acid promoted additions of long chained alcohols to 2- carbomethoxy-1,4-benzoquinone (1) have been examined by using various LAs; AlCl3, TiCl4, MgBr2 and MgCl2. It has been found that the bidentate Lewis acid MgCl2, having ability to coordinate to both carbonyl oxygens (chelate control) of 2-carbomethoxy-1,4-benzoquinone (1), produced the addition product almost quantitatively at mild conditions. The MgCl2 catalyzed additions of alcohols have been utilized in the synthesis of rare 2- alkoxyhydroquinones (7a-e). The reactions between quinone 1, alcohol and AlCl3 or TiCl4 have also been investigated by using NMR spectroscopy.
